The OM System OM-5 Mark II is tailored for both professional photographers and serious hobbyists who require a reliable, high-performance camera that combines portability with the resilience to handle a variety of environments. It is especially suited for those engaged in travel photography, vlogging, and outdoor photo sessions where weather conditions can be unpredictable. It features a 20.4MP Live MOS Micro Four Thirds sensor, designed to capture high-resolution images with exceptional clarity and color accuracy, perfect for both professional and enthusiast photographers. Empowered by the TruePic IX image processor, the camera enhances every aspect of image and video creation from autofocus speed to image processing capabilities, ensuring quick and efficient performance. The video capabilities supports DCI 4K at 24 fps and UHD 4K at 30 fps video recording, catering to filmmakers and videographers looking to produce high-quality content with compact gear. An integrated 5-axis sensor-shift image stabilization helps to minimize camera shake, making it ideal for handheld shooting in low-light conditions or when using longer focal lengths.

The OM System OM-5 Mark II utilizes a 121-point hybrid autofocus system that combines contrast and phase detection methods for quick, accurate, and reliable autofocus performance in various shooting conditions. The camera is equipped with a 2.36m-dot OLED electronic viewfinder for a clear, high-contrast view of the scene, along with a 3.0" 1.04m-dot vari-angle touchscreen that enhances usability for shooting from tricky angles or for vlogging. It includes built-in Wi-Fi and Bluetooth for easy sharing and remote camera control, which enhances workflow efficiencies for those who need to transfer images and videos quickly to other devices or platforms. It comes with an SD memory card slot, providing flexible storage options and the capability to expand storage as needed. The compact and lightweight design makes it an excellent choice for travel photographers or anyone who needs a high-performance camera that won’t weigh them down.

The OM System OM-5 Mark II Compact System Camera stands as a versatile and robust tool for photography and videography, combining advanced technological features like a high-resolution sensor, powerful image stabilization, and 4K video capabilities in a durable, weather-sealed body. With its compact design and the inclusion of both high-performance imaging properties and connectivity options, this camera is designed to offer a comprehensive imaging experience for creators who demand flexibility, reliability, and quality in their photographic equipment.


Product Features in Detail

 

OM SYSTEM OM-5 Mark II at a glance
The OM-5 Mark II is an ultra-compact, lightweight mirrorless camera designed for outdoor enthusiasts and adventurers who demand top-tier image quality without the bulk. Weighing only 14.7 ounces (with battery and SD card), it’s the ideal companion for travel, hiking photography, and spontaneous videography—offering robust performance in a highly portable form.


Unmatched image quality | Sharp, stable, and vibrant shots—wherever you go.
Experience stunning clarity, even in challenging conditions. The OM-5 Mark II combines a powerful sensor and processor with advanced image stabilization and premium lenses—delivering sharp, vibrant results wherever your journey takes you.


Stunning image quality
Capture every trail, peak, and forest in rich color and crisp detail—thanks to the 20MP sensor and TruePic IX processor, making every outdoor memory unforgettable.


Up to 7.5 EV 5-axis sync IS
Say goodbye to shaky shots. The advanced 5-axis sync IS stabilization keeps your handheld photos and videos sharp—even on rocky trails or in fading light.


Extensive lens lineup
From wide-angle to telephoto, explore a full range of weather-sealed M.Zuiko lenses, built to withstand the same tough conditions as your camera.


Compact and durable | Ready for the trail, regardless of the weather.
At just 14.7 ounces, the OM-5 Mark II is built to move with you—light, compact, and rugged. IP53-certified weather sealing ensures it thrives in rain, dust, or snow, keeping you free to explore, regardless of the conditions.


IP53-certified weatherproofing
Don't let the weather stop you. With IP53-certified weather sealing, the camera is protected against dust, rain, and cold, allowing you to capture your adventures in any environment.


Compact & lightweight
At just 14.7 ounces (with battery and SD card), this camera is the perfect companion for long hikes and remote expeditions—easy to carry, tough enough to handle the wild.


USB charging
Quickly charge on the go with USB-C. Connect a power bank to keep your camera powered up, ensuring you're ready for every moment, wherever your journey takes you.


Computational photography button | Creativity inspired by the wonders of nature.
Unlock advanced creative tools on the OM-5 Mark II, including High-Res Shot, Live ND, Focus Stacking, HDR, and Multiple Exposure—just a tap away via the CP-Button for fast, intuitive access to pro-level features. Built for spontaneous creativity in the wild.


High-Res Shot
Capture ultra-detailed 50–80MP images with HighRes Shot—even handheld. Perfect for wide mountain vistas, forest textures, and all the natural details.


Live ND
Create smooth motion effects in waterfalls, rivers, or skies—even in broad daylight—without physical filters. Live ND (ND2–16) makes long-exposure shots spontaneous and effortless.


Focus Stacking
Perfect your macro and landscape shots. In-camera Focus Stacking merges different focus points into a single image with a greater depth of field—ideal for flowers, insects, and landscapes.


HDR
Capture scenes with extreme contrast—from sunlit peaks to deep forest shadows—with rich detail in both shadows and highlights using in-camera HDR.


Multiple Exposure
Combine scenes and create artistic blends directly in-camera. Experiment with light, shadow, and texture on your hikes and explorations.


High autofocus performance | Capture every split second.
Whether it's a fleeting wildlife shot or fast-moving action, the OM-5 Mark II's 121 AF points, 30fps shooting, and Pro Capture ensure you capture every adventure in stunning detail.


Fast Phase Detection AF
With 121 cross-type AF points and phase detection, the camera quickly locks onto subjects, delivering sharp, precise focus—even for fast-moving scenes on land or in the sky.


Pro Capture
Wildlife moves faster than we can react—so should your camera. Pro Capture buffers images before the shutter is fully pressed, so you never miss the perfect moment in uncompromised RAW quality.


Silent up to 30fps burst mode shooting
Capture fast action in complete silence with 10fps (C-AF) or 30fps (S-AF) sequential shooting—perfect for wildlife, sports, or any moment where silence is golden.


Nighttime photography | When the light fades, the magic begins.
From starlit skies to long exposures, the OM-5 Mark II lets you capture the magic of the night with Starry Sky AF, Night Vision Mode, and Live Composite—all easily accessible for stunning low-light creativity, without the need for additional equipment or guesswork.


Live Composite
Paint the night with stars, lightning, or light trails. Live Composite stacks only new light, allowing you to watch your masterpiece build in real time—without overexposure.


Starry Sky AF
A skill that takes years to master, now behind one button. Starry Sky AF locks sharp focus on stars, allowing you to capture stunning astro shots with ease.


Night Vision mode
Preserve your night vision during moonlit hikes or stargazing with a live view that stays visible in low light, allowing for stealthy shooting without disrupting your vision.


Video features | Tell your story through video
The OM-5 Mark II delivers stunning 4K, smooth slow-motion video, a log profile for true colors, and vertical video for social media—film your explorations in breathtaking detail.


4K 30P and Full HD 120P
Capture stunning 4K footage at 30 fps for crisp, detailed video of your explorations, or slow down the action with Full HD 120 fps for smooth, cinematic moments in nature.


Vertical video
Capture vertical video for easy sharing on social media—perfect for showcasing your outdoor moments and discoveries in a format made for your followers.


OM-Log400
OM-Log400 preserves rich detail in both highlights and shadows, giving you greater flexibility when editing—ideal for capturing the full range of outdoor scenes.


Free iOS and Android app | Share your stories and control your camera outdoors
Hiking alone but want to take those epic selfies in stunning landscapes? Control your OM-5 Mark II camera, share your stories, and capture every moment—all with the Wi-Fi & Bluetooth LE feature.


Wi-Fi & Bluetooth Low Energy
Control your camera remotely, geotag images, or share epic moments in higher quality, all from the trail when paired with your camera through the OI.Share app.


The free OI.Share App
Wireless remote control, camera live view on your mobile device screen, and browsing and importing images—even with the camera in your backpack. The OI.Share app does it all.

High res shot
Shutter type Electronic shutter
Shutter speed 1/8000 - 60s
Start delay 0, 1/8, 1/4, 1/2, 1, 2, 4, 8, 15. 30s
Resolution JPEG: 10368x7776 / 8160 x 6120 / 5760 x 4320 RAW: 10368 x 7776
Equivalent to 80M / 50M / 25M pixel sensor (8 shots combined into a single JPEG using sensor shift)
Available in P/A/S/M mode
Note You need to install OM Workspace to develop on a PC.
Handheld High res shot
Shutter type Electronic shutter
Shutter speed 1/8000 - 60s
Resolution JPEG: 8160 x 6120 / 5760 x 4320 RAW: 8160 x 6120
Equivalent to 50M / 25M pixel sensor (8 shots combined into a single JPEG using sensor shift)
Available in P/A/S/M mode
Flash can not be used
Anti-shock mode
Shutter type Electronic first curtain shutter
Shutter speed 1/320* - 60s
Start delay 0, 1/8, 1/4, 1/2, 1, 2, 4, 8, 15, 30s
Note * For speeds over 1/320 sec., mechanical shutter will automatically be selected.
